本文目录导读:
数据加密技术作为信息安全领域的重要基石,历经数千年发展,从古典密码到量子加密,实现了从简单到复杂、从被动到主动的演变,本文将带您回顾数据加密技术的发展历程,探寻其背后的奥秘。
古典密码时代
1、古典密码的起源
古典密码的起源可以追溯到古代,最早的密码出现在公元前2000年左右的古埃及,当时,人们为了保护信息不被他人窃取,采用了一种简单的替换法,即用字母、数字或其他符号来代替原有的信息。
2、古典密码的演变
图片来源于网络,如有侵权联系删除
随着社会的发展,古典密码逐渐从简单的替换法发展到更为复杂的加密方式,较为著名的古典密码有凯撒密码、维吉尼亚密码、一次一密密码等。
(1)凯撒密码:这是一种最简单的替换密码,通过将字母表中的每个字母向前或向后移动固定位数来实现加密,将字母表中的每个字母向后移动3位,得到加密后的字母。
(2)维吉尼亚密码:这是一种多字母替换密码,通过将字母表分成多个部分,然后根据密钥的指示进行替换,维吉尼亚密码的密钥可以是任意长度,且密钥与明文之间没有固定的对应关系。
(3)一次一密密码:这是一种更为安全的古典密码,密钥长度与明文等长,且每个密钥只使用一次,一次一密密码的密钥通常采用纸条或卡片等方式生成,保证了加密的安全性。
近代密码学时代
1、概率论密码学的兴起
19世纪末,随着概率论和数论的发展,密码学开始进入近代密码学时代,近代密码学的主要特点是利用数学理论来分析密码的安全性。
2、近代密码学的代表人物
近代密码学的代表人物有香农、希尔、恩斯特·费舍尔等。
图片来源于网络,如有侵权联系删除
(1)香农:被誉为“信息论之父”,提出了信息熵、信道容量等概念,为密码学的发展奠定了理论基础。
(2)希尔:英国数学家,提出了希尔密码,这是一种基于线性代数的分组密码。
(3)恩斯特·费舍尔:德国密码学家,提出了费舍尔密码,这是一种基于有限域的分组密码。
现代密码学时代
1、分组密码和流密码
现代密码学的主要特点是采用分组密码和流密码来保护信息安全。
(1)分组密码:将明文分成固定长度的数据块,然后对每个数据块进行加密,分组密码的代表有DES、AES等。
(2)流密码:将明文分成固定长度的数据流,然后对每个数据流进行加密,流密码的代表有RC4、S-DES等。
2、公钥密码学
图片来源于网络,如有侵权联系删除
公钥密码学是现代密码学的一个重要分支,其主要思想是使用一对密钥,一个用于加密,另一个用于解密,公钥密码学的代表有RSA、ECC等。
量子加密时代
1、量子加密的原理
量子加密是利用量子力学原理来实现信息安全的一种加密方式,其主要思想是利用量子纠缠和量子不可克隆原理,使得加密信息在传输过程中无法被窃取。
2、量子加密的应用
量子加密在信息安全领域具有广泛的应用前景,如量子密钥分发、量子密码通信等。
数据加密技术历经数千年发展,从古典密码到量子加密,实现了从简单到复杂、从被动到主动的演变,随着科技的不断进步,未来数据加密技术将继续朝着更高安全性、更高效能的方向发展。
标签: #数据加密技术的发展历史
评论列表